No s'ha de confondre amb pic. |
PIC | |
---|---|
Fabricant | Microchip Technology |
Lloc web | microchip.com |
El PIC és un microcontrolador amb arquitectura Harvard, fabricats per "Microchip Technology". Deriven del PIC1650[1][2][3] desenvolupats inicialment per la divisió de microelectrònica de General Instrument. El nom PIC inicialment es referia a "Peripheral Interface Controller".[4][5] és a dir, microcontrolador de connexió perifèric, passant més tard a anomenar-se'n "Programmable Intelligent Computer". La fama i el coneixement per aquest producte s'obté a partir del baix cost, àmplia disponibilitat i base d'usuaris, amplies possibilitats per aplicacions amb documents, disponibilitat de baixos costos o gratuïtes eines de desenvolupament i forces sèries de programacions o reprogramacions amb memòries flash.
Els PICs tenen un conjunt de registres que funcionen com a memòria RAM de propòsit general. Registres de control especials sobre els recursos de maquinari xip, que s'assignen a l'espai de dades. L'adreçament de la memòria varia depenent de la sèrie de dispositius, i tots els dispositius PIC disposen d'un mecanisme bancari per ampliar el front de la memòria addicional. Més tard la sèrie de dispositius amb instruccions poden cobrir l'espai direccionable en el seu conjunt, independentment del banc seleccionat.
El PIC original es va dissenyar per a ser usat amb la nova CPU de 16 bits CP16000. Sent en general una bona CPU, aquesta tenia males prestacions de E/S, i el PIC de 8 bits es va desenvolupar el 1975 per millorar el rendiment del sistema traient pes d'E/S a la CPU. El PIC utilitzava microcodi simple emmagatzemat en memòria ROM per a realitzar aquestes tasques, i encara que el terme no s'usava en aquell moment, es tracta d'un disseny RISC que executa una instrucció cada 4 cicles de l'oscil·lador.